The Forklift Operator / Bulk Operator Operates strapping machines and automatic palletizers; supplies load-building materials; moves loads from work area using fork lift.
The Forklift Operator / Bulk Operator will:
- Maintains supply of pallets, tier sheets, shrouds, strapping, and other material required for palletizing and strapping ware.
- Checks for proper application of straps around pallet loads (bulk and cased); places string ties and manually straps when required.
- Operates hi-lift tractor to transport and store materials and loads.
- Operates automatic palletizer, and automatic strapping machine, to prepare loads of ware.
- Unjams strapping machine and automatic palletizers as required.
- Straightens loads, replaces bottles, discards damaged bulking materials, straightens and unjams pallets in hopper. Checks load integrity.
- Takes roll of strapping material (60 lbs) to area, remove and replace spool of strapping material.
- Checks strapper tension with tension meter to make sure load is secured.
- Using forklift serves and make sure all shops are supplied with pallets, tier sheets, frames.
- Secures and transport resort loads as required.
- Checks oil level in VFC regulators of automatic palletizers.
- Places rolls of wrap on stretch-wrapper as required. Manually operates stretch wrapper if out of automatic mode.
- Identify problems with equipment; may very minor adjustments and reports malfunction of equipment to Foreman or other designated employee.
- May manually palletize loads when automatic equipment malfunctions.
- Applies bar code tickets to production units. Checks for proper printing on carton flaps.
- Fill forklift with fuel and fill out mobile equipment inspection sheet for maintenance.
- Performs clean-up and good housekeeping duties.
